I tend to visit "Hardware Hangout" and "Overclocking and PC Modding" a fair amount of times over the course of the day and over the weeks after the introduction of threads like the temperature database and post your workstation the overall number of other threads has decreased a fair amount.

Getting to the point, the question Im asking is do you think it would be a viable solution to introduce a [benchmark] thread. By this I mean a place where people can post and compare benchmark score with others in a less ad hoc manner than usually takes place.

The only problem I see is the varied amount of benchmarks out there, but the ones that appear to be common place are Sisoft sandras cpu/multi media benchmarks and the 3D Mark series benchmarks.

Knowing this, it appears to be a simple matter of stating:

CPU (rating and speed)

Memory (rating and speed)

Graphics

Hard Drive

OS install (fresh old etc)

Benchmark type + images

cooling (maybe)

Do you think this is a valid option or just overkill considering the present OC thread does include benchmarks?
